Description
As part of its wider Armouries 700 masterplan, the Royal Armouries is seeking tenders from experienced, successful consultants to undertake and present a compelling Business Case, consistent with the Treasury Five Cases model, for development of the Tiltyard at Leeds Dock, supported by a robust Green Book Appraisal that demonstrates the value of investment. The c. 2,500m2 Tiltyard site includes the Tiltyard itself, a large open air jousting arena; a stables and mews (originally intended as a year-round attraction but now only used occasionally to support seasonal events) and the Craft Court, a space originally intended for traditional craft demonstration and retail but now used mainly for storage and maintenance workshops.
